    Best Practices in Synchronous Online Learning: A Profile for Student Success

    No full text
    This presentation introduces the Student Success Profile (SSP), a cornerstone of ASPIRE Academy\u27s innovative approach to synchronous online learning. Designed to assess and support student acquisition of Essential Competencies for Synchronous Online Learning (ECSOL), the SSP ensures alignment with the school\u27s mission of fostering academic rigor, spiritual growth, and personal transformation. Participants will explore how these quarterly evaluations guide targeted support, promote excellence, and uphold high academic standards. Discover how the SSP nurtures holistic development, helping students excel in an online, dynamic, interactive, and values-driven learning environment

    Foundational Ear Training

    Get PDF
    Overview:This book is intended to facilitate the development of aural skills in a variety of ways over the course of a two-year ear training course. Included are sixteen chapters of exercises that progressively develop the reader\u27s abilities in the areas of: interval recognition, rhythmic pattern detection and performance, rhythmic sight-reading and dictation, scale degree recognition, melodic sight-singing and dictation, chord recognition, and harmonic dictation.
